Our client is one of the world’s largest wholesale and retail distributors of hair and beauty products, operating more than 4,500 stores across the United States, Europe, and Latin America. Headquartered in Denton, Texas, the company has built a global footprint by ensuring beauty is accessible, inclusive, and expressive for every community they serve.
With decades of success behind them, the organization remains focused on transformation—both in their physical footprint and in how they deliver customer value through innovation, M&A, and long-range strategic planning.
As the company looked to redefine its future in a rapidly evolving retail and consumer landscape, leadership identified the need for a senior strategy executive to drive innovation, long-term growth planning, and market analysis.
